Responsibilities
- Work with simulations to develop recommendations and maintain system integration labs, facilities, and analysis tools.
- Conduct M&S activities in support of analyses, exercises, wargames, and experiments conducted by the Government.
- Provide instruction, supervision, and guidance on the proper operation and use of simulation models and exercises.
- Support live, constructive, or virtual training.
- Utilize RF modeling and simulation software to manipulate antenna and power models that visualize GPS denial in potentially affected areas.
- Exhibit proficiency with GIANT, GIANT RPM, Builder, Systems Toolkit (STK), or other modeling and simulation programs.
